数据库相关
文章平均质量分 79
追梦java
这个作者很懒,什么都没留下…
展开
-
oracle 常用的函数
<br />SELECT CONCAT('CG',lpad(AM_APPLY_SEQUENCE.nextval, 5, '0')) as code FROM DUAL;<br /> <br />concat拼接字符串<br />concat(Str1,str2)拼接str1和str2<br /> <br />lpad函数<br />lpad( string1, padded_length, [ pad_string ] )<br /> 其中string1是需要粘贴字符的字符串<br /> p原创 2010-12-02 09:02:00 · 407 阅读 · 0 评论 -
hibernate使用3p0
"-//Hibernate/Hibernate Configuration DTD 3.0//EN" "http://hibernate.sourceforge.net/hibernate-configuration-3.0.dtd"> false false jdbc:oracle:thin:@172.17.88.102:1521:ORCL pip pip原创 2012-10-15 09:25:35 · 501 阅读 · 0 评论 -
批量修改sqlserver 字段默认值
批量修改sqlserver 字段wid 默认值 package com.pm360.pip.test;import java.sql.Connection;import java.sql.ResultSet;import java.sql.SQLException;import java.sql.Statement;import javax.naming.Contex原创 2012-09-17 14:16:24 · 3586 阅读 · 0 评论 -
Merge into 详细介绍
Merge into 详细介绍/*Merge into 详细介绍MERGE语句是Oracle9i新增的语法,用来合并UPDATE和INSERT语句。通过MERGE语句,根据一张表或子查询的连接条件对另外一张表进行查询,连接条件匹配上的进行UPDATE,无法匹配的执行INSERT。这个语法仅需要一次全表扫描就完成了全部工作,执行效率要高于INSER转载 2012-06-29 14:36:02 · 477 阅读 · 0 评论 -
表关联查询
一、内连接和外连接 内连接用于返回满足连接条件的记录;而外连接则是内连接的扩展,它不仅会满足连接条件的记录,而且还会返回不满足连接条件的记录,语法如下: Oracle代码 1. select table1.column,table2.column from table1 [inner|left|right|full]join table2 on table1.c原创 2012-04-28 09:58:14 · 548 阅读 · 0 评论 -
oracle函数汇总
SQL中的单记录函数1.ASCII返回与指定的字符对应的十进制数;SQL> select ascii('A') A,ascii('a') a,ascii('0') zero,ascii(' ') space from dual; A A ZERO SPACE--------- --------- --------- -------原创 2012-02-07 16:08:12 · 675 阅读 · 0 评论 -
CLOB字段的插入以及更新操作 .
1. 插入方法,首先需要先插入一个空的CLOB对象,之后查询出该条对象,并进行更新操作:view plaincopy to clipboardprint?01.@Override 02.public void add(Object obj) throws DAOException { 03. 04. Connection conn = null; 05.转载 2011-10-28 15:57:50 · 3302 阅读 · 0 评论 -
ora-01033 ORACLE initialization or shutdown in progress 解决方案
连Microsoft Windows [版本 6.1.7600]版权所有 (c) 2009 Microsoft Corporation。保留所有权利。C:\Users\Admin>sqlplus / as sysdbaSQL*Plus: Release 10.2.0.转载 2011-08-16 09:41:48 · 720 阅读 · 0 评论 -
解决用B表跟新A表数据,如果A表中没有,则把B表的数据插入A表(merge into)
作用:merge into 解决用B表跟新A表数据,如果A表中没有,则把B表的数据插入A表;语法:MERGE INTO [your table-name] [rename your table here]USING ( [write your query here] )[rena原创 2011-07-22 16:26:50 · 2194 阅读 · 0 评论 -
java 操作执行 imp、exp命令
<br />package com.pm360.pip.sys.web;<br />import java.io.BufferedReader;<br />import java.io.IOException;<br />import java.io.InputStreamReader;<br />import java.util.HashMap;<br />import com.pm360.mda.platform.util.StringUtil;<br />/**<br /> * @author XuF原创 2011-04-23 16:25:00 · 4146 阅读 · 0 评论 -
Oracle数据的导入导出 imp ,exp 两个命令详解
<br />本文对Oracle数据的导入导出 imp ,exp 两个命令进行了介绍, 并对其相应的参数进行了说明,然后通过一些示例进行演练,加深理解.<br />文章最后对运用这两个命令可能出现的问题(如权限不够,不同oracle版本)进行了探讨,并提出了相应的解决方案;<br />本文部分内容摘录自网络,感谢网友的经验总结;<br /><br />一.说明<br /> oracle 的exp/imp命令用于实现对数据库的导出/导入操作;<br /> exp命令用于把数据从远程数据库服务器导出至本地转载 2011-04-23 16:18:00 · 1049 阅读 · 0 评论 -
linux平台 oracle 数据库 安装文档
<br />Oracle 官方的安装文档<br />http://download.oracle.com/docs/cd/B28359_01/install.111/b32002/toc.htm<br /> <br /> <br />一. 安装相关包<br /> 1.1 在redhat 4 上安装10g 需要如下包:<br />Required package versions (or later): <br />binutils-2.15.92.0.2-10.EL4 <br />compat-db-4.1转载 2011-05-11 23:00:00 · 674 阅读 · 0 评论 -
Oracle 递归查询
<br />比如模块表 mod <br />字段 <br />number modId <br />number parentModId <br />varchar modName <br /><br />从下往上查 <br />select * from mod m start with m.modId = ? connect by prior m.parentModId = m.modId <br /><br />从上往下查 <br />select * from mod m start with m.原创 2011-02-24 18:23:00 · 547 阅读 · 0 评论 -
Oracle客户端工具配置【Navicat、PL/SQL Developer】
到Oracle官网下载新版的instantclient,利用这种客户端的方式,不需要在机器上装上Oracle数据库,Oracle数据库体积太大,占据一定的硬盘和内存空间,下载新版本的原因是Oracle的版本都是高版本兼容低版本的。在Oracle官网下载客户端软件,下载完成后解压到指定的目录,以我机器为例解压到:D:\PLSQL_MAPPING\instantclient-basic-win原创 2014-12-09 08:46:49 · 3548 阅读 · 0 评论